Transaction 70b436af9bbfb4aaa94359528b7ffcf369d4280c00be5a639d7ed9fa9f45bbf6
2 Input
2 Outputs
- 70b436af9bbfb4aaa94359528b7ffcf369d4280c00be5a639d7ed9fa9f45bbf6:0
- 70b436af9bbfb4aaa94359528b7ffcf369d4280c00be5a639d7ed9fa9f45bbf6:1
value 1882101
address 33AEx2Kacsese5gDfdcMsh7XZbgYVoPZie
value 74750731
address 1PC6TjmjysUaNLmHKTv76CrZ3bK4z4Xcys